after upgrading to the latest version the powershell dlls and psd1 are missing...in the program directory

in the patchnotes : Automatically install Remote Desktop Manager PowerShell module if it is not detected when launcher a PowerShell session requiring it

but this does not happen also when i launch from inside rdm /tools/powershell we get the error that the module cannot be loaded...

i attach a screen...where is the powershell module gone? i already did a uninstall and full reinstall...as you can see in the latest screen only powershellmaml.dll is there where is the rest?

For now, you can install the module by running this command: Install-Module RemoteDesktopManager
